Hip-hop artist Macklemore sparked controversy during a recent concert in New Jersey by publicly declaring support for the "Free Palestine" movement and leveling accusations against Israel, including claims of genocide in Gaza. The statements, made onstage at the Meadowlands venue, drew immediate attention amid ongoing geopolitical tensions in the region. While the artist has a history of outspoken activism, his latest remarks have reignited debates over artistic expression and political advocacy in music. Supporters and critics alike are weighing in on whether performers should use their platform to address global conflicts.
